Znaczenie i definicje "entropy"

Noun

(communication theory) a numerical measure of the uncertainty of an outcome; "the signal contained thousands of bits of information"

Synonimy:

Noun

(thermodynamics) a thermodynamic quantity representing the amount of energy in a system that is no longer available for doing mechanical work; "entropy increases as matter and energy in the universe degrade to an ultimate state of inert uniformity"
